Understanding the Impact of Infestations
To be honest, I initially regarded a few bugs as inconsequential. However, it wasn’t long before I realized that pest infestations can have serious repercussions. Beyond mere annoyance, these uninvited guests can pose health risks to both my family and pets. Rodents and stickroaches, for instance, are notorious carriers of harmful diseases. And let’s not forget about termites—these little creatures can quietly wreak havoc on the very structure of your home.
Every time I spotted a pest darting across the kitchen or discovered a sticky patch I had overlooked, my anxiety mounted. I learned the hard way that disregarding a pest problem can lead to escalating damage. Some pests breed at an alarming rate, leading to exponential growth of the issue. Understanding this reality is vital; knowledge often empowers proactive measures—it’s true what they say, sometimes prevention really is the best medicine.

Knowing When to Call in the Experts
Eventually, I reached a point where I could no longer ignore the growing evidence of a pest issue; it became clear that it was time to enlist professional help. If you find persistent indications like frequent pest sightings, severe infestations, or noticeable damage around your home, don’t hesitate to take action. Ignoring these signs can lead to prolonged anxiety and even potential health risks.
There’s no shame in seeking assistance when it’s needed. I’ve learned that pest control experts come equipped with the knowledge and tools necessary to effectively tackle infestations. They can also offer insights into preventive measures to help keep those pesky visitors at bay. In hindsight, I wish I had reached out for help earlier—it would have saved me both time and unnecessary stress.
